Subject: DR drill tomorrow — pricing experiment data

Hey,

Quick heads-up: tomorrow we're running the disaster-recovery drill for the Farejoy ticket-pricing experiment. We'll simulate losing the experiment config store and restore from the cold snapshot. Your job is just to verify variant assignments come back consistent. When the restore tool asks for authentication, use the recovery passphrase below.

unlock words, hahip-baduf: holwyn-istath-julvan

Ticket: UserCore split — config drift on staging

Staging for the extracted user module (UserCore) no longer matches what the monolith (Pellwright) ships. Someone hand-edited session timeouts and hash rounds during the cutover test and never backported. Don't trust the repo copy until this is reconciled. Current effective staging values are as follows.

service settings:
[silwyn]
host = silwyn.crelvogrid.internal
user = silwyn_svc
database = silwyn_prod

**Ticket: Samplr config vault locked itself again**

So the vault holding the log-sampling rules for ChatterPipe (our famously chatty ingest service) auto-locked after the cert rotation, and now nobody can tune sample rates. We're stuck at 100% capture, which is hammering storage. Future maintainers: this happens every rotation, sorry. To unlock it, open the vault console and enter the recovery passphrase given below.

strongbox words: briiel-zoreth-noveth-pelys-druwyn-feniel-lamvan-ulaius-kasion

☐ Step 9 — Re-seed spindlerot, the internal secrets-rotation utility, after key generation. Future maintainers: confirm the new root key is registered in the rotation manifest, that all downstream service tokens are marked for rotation within 24 hours, and that the previous keyring is tombstoned rather than deleted. Two witnesses initial the ceremony log before proceeding. The final action is unlocking the offline escrow module, which accepts only the ceremony recovery passphrase; the scribe records it on the following line.

recovery phrase for bawep-kawef: oliath-casdor